Abstract

The invention belongs to the technical field of formaldehyde production, and particularly relates to a formaldehyde evaporator for producing formaldehyde. The device comprises a formaldehyde evaporator, a sealing tank opening is fixedly formed in the top of the formaldehyde evaporator, an absorption pipe is fixedly connected to the exterior of the formaldehyde evaporator, and a feeding opening is fixedly formed in the outer surface wall of the formaldehyde evaporator; the outer surface wall of the bottom of the formaldehyde evaporator is fixedly connected with a release pipe groove, the bottom of the formaldehyde evaporator is fixedly connected with a connecting pipe opening, the interior of the formaldehyde evaporator is fixedly connected with a formaldehyde absorber, and the interior of the formaldehyde absorber is fixedly connected with a bee absorbing opening. By arranging the formaldehyde evaporator capable of circularly absorbing, the concentration of formaldehyde evaporated by the formaldehyde evaporator is improved, and the concentration of a formaldehyde aqueous solution is ensured. According to the equipment, formaldehyde can be fully extracted, and formaldehyde residues and formaldehyde pollution are avoided; in addition, the equipment avoids formaldehyde leakage in the reproduction process, the safety coefficient of processing production is improved, and potential safety hazards are reduced.

technical field [0001] The invention relates to the technical field of formaldehyde production, in particular to a formaldehyde evaporator for producing formaldehyde. Background technique [0002] Formaldehyde is a popular chemical product with a wide range of uses, simple production process and sufficient supply of raw materials. It is the backbone of methanol's downstream product tree. The world's annual output is about 25 million tons, and about 30% of methanol is used to produce formaldehyde. However, formaldehyde is an aqueous solution with a low concentration, which is not convenient for long-distance transportation from an economic point of view. The existing production process of formaldehyde often uses evaporation and collection. The traditional formaldehyde evaporator on the market is used to produce formaldehyde.
